What Is A Holographic Rigid Box?
A holographic rigid box is a high-quality packaging solution that combines the visual impact of holographic materials with the structural integrity of a rigid box.
Features
- Made from thick, non-folding materials like chipboard or heavy paperboard, providing exceptional durability and resistance to crushing.
- Provides robust protection during shipping and storage.
- The holographic material can be combined with various printing techniques, embossing, debossing, and foil stamping to create unique designs.
- High-quality manufacturing ensures clean edges, tight corners, and a flawless finish.
- Often includes precisely fitted inserts to hold products securely.

Artwork Preparation Guide
At BoxesGen, our Artwork Preparation Guide helps ensure your custom packaging design is print-ready for high-quality results. To get started, submit vector files (AI, EPS, or PDF) in CMYK color mode, with a 1/8 inch bleed and 300 DPI resolution. Convert all text to outlines and keep it at least 1/4 inch from the edges. Review your proof to ensure accuracy before submitting. Following these steps will guarantee your design is perfectly printed on your custom boxes.

Cut Line (Black Lines):
The cut line is the outline that marks where your custom packaging will be trimmed. It is typically represented by a solid black line in your artwork file.
Perforation (Dotted Black Lines):
Perforation lines, shown as dotted black lines, indicate where the box will have small, evenly spaced holes for easy tearing or separation. These are often used for tear-away sections.
Bleed Line (Green Lines):
The bleed line is the area extending beyond the cut line, usually marked with a green line in your artwork. Typically, a 1/8 inch (0.125") bleed is required to prevent any unwanted white borders.
Safety Margin (Dotted Green Lines):
The safety margin, marked by dotted green lines, is the area around the cut line where important elements (such as text, logos, or graphics) should be kept clear.
Crease Line (Red Lines)
The crease line, marked by red lines in your artwork, indicates where the box will be folded during production.
